Commercial Slab Installation Questions
What types of projects require commercial slab installation? Commercial slab installation is typically used for building foundations, parking lots, loading docks, and outdoor work areas on commercial properties.
How thick should a commercial concrete slab be? The thickness varies based on the intended use, but common thicknesses range from 4 to 6 inches for standard applications and thicker for heavy loads.
What factors affect the durability of a commercial slab? Proper site preparation, quality materials, and appropriate reinforcement help ensure the slab’s durability and longevity.
Is a permit needed for commercial slab installation? Permit requirements depend on local regulations and the scope of the project; it's advisable to check with local authorities before starting work.
